Pharmaceutical companies have a heightened interest in sustainable practices. Some of the largest pharma companies in the industry have recently committed to sustainability goals regarding emissions, with most companies focusing on carbon footprint.

Improving Sustainability Scores of Pharmaceutical Packaging Main

Critical processes in the pharma industry that contribute to carbon footprint are the production of pharmaceutical products, production of pharmaceutical packaging, supply chain, and end-of-life disposal.

Although packaging is only a share of the overall impact, packaging suppliers can support the pharmaceutical industry’s goals by considering environmental impact when designing packaging. Comparing different materials and designs through a Life Cycle Assessment system allows suppliers to make informed decisions on what materials and package formats to use.

Amcor’s Advanced Sustainability Stewardship Evaluation Tool (ASSET™) is a proprietary tool for Life Cycle Assessments (LCAs) that measures the environmental impact from raw materials to end-of-use, offering a simple and effective way to compare two packages.

Understand how your packaging affects the environment

It can be tough to comprehend the frequently unseen environmental impact of your packaging. Amcor’s Life Cycle Assessment (LCA) tool was created to examine the environmental impact at each stage of a product's life cycle. ASSET™ Life Cycle Assessment provides a detailed and fact-based evaluation of different packaging choices by looking at the full life cycle, including the extraction of raw materials, production and usage, through to end of life.
